Material Quality and Grade Certification

The foundation of any great bolt is its material. We verified that each brand complies with key industry standards for material properties and certification. This includes adherence to specifications from:

  • ASTM (American Society for Testing and Materials)
  • ISO (International Organization for Standardization)
  • DIN (German Institute for Standardization)

We specifically checked for proper head markings corresponding to grades like ISO 898-1 (e.g., Class 8.8, 10.9) and ASTM A325, ensuring the bolts meet their claimed specifications.

Corrosion Resistance and Coating Quality

Durability is often determined by a bolt’s ability to resist environmental decay. We assessed the quality and type of protective coatings, from standard zinc plating to advanced proprietary systems. Bolts underwent aggressive salt spray tests, referencing benchmarks like ISO 9227, to measure their resistance to rust and corrosion over time.

Pro Tip: A bolt’s coating directly impacts its lifespan. For example, a standard zinc-plated bolt may last 500 hours in a salt spray test, while advanced coatings like Dacromet® can exceed 1,000 hours, making them ideal for harsher environments.

Stainless Steel and Duplex Steel Options

Dokka moves beyond coated carbon steel. The company offers an extensive range of bolts made from high-grade stainless steels (like A4/316) and advanced duplex stainless steels. These materials contain chromium and molybdenum, which create a passive, self-repairing oxide layer that naturally resists rust and pitting.

Galvanic Corrosion Prevention

Dokka engineers its fasteners to prevent galvanic corrosion. This destructive process occurs when two dissimilar metals are in contact in the presence of an electrolyte, like saltwater. Dokka provides materials that are compatible with common structural metals, protecting the entire assembly from accelerated decay.

Expert Insight: Duplex stainless steel combines the best properties of austenitic and ferritic steels. This gives Dokka bolts superior strength and exceptional resistance to stress corrosion cracking, a common failure mode in chloride-rich environments like seawater.

Impact sockets are designed for use with impact wrenches. They are made from softer, more ductile steel that can withstand the high torque and repeated impacts of power tools without shattering.

Torque Wrenches

A torque wrench is a critical tool for applying a precise amount of rotational force (torque) to a fastener. This prevents over-tightening, which can damage threads, and under-tightening, which can lead to loose connections.

Critical Safety Note: Improper torquing creates significant risks. In aviation, an inadequately torqued nut led to a fatal helicopter crash. In the automotive industry, General Motors once recalled nearly 6 million vehicles due to fastener issues, costing an estimated $1.2 billion. The initial cost of a high-precision wrench is minimal compared to the cost of failure.

Click-Type Torque Wrenches

These affordable and durable wrenches are easy to use. The operator sets the desired torque, and the tool produces an audible “click” when the value is reached. However, they require regular calibration and careful attention from the user to avoid over-tightening.

Digital Torque Wrenches

Digital wrenches offer the highest accuracy. They provide real-time readings on an electronic display and use alerts like lights, beeps, or vibrations to signal that the target torque has been met. While more expensive and delicate, their data logging capabilities are essential for industries requiring compliance and traceability.

What is the main difference between Grade 5 and Grade 8 bolts?

Grade 8 bolts possess a higher tensile strength than Grade 5 bolts. Manufacturers use a stronger alloy steel for Grade 8, making them ideal for high-stress applications. Grade 5 bolts are made from medium-strength carbon steel and are suitable for most general-purpose fastening needs.

Why is hot-dip galvanizing better than standard zinc plating?

Hot-dip galvanizing (HDG) creates a thick, metallurgically bonded zinc layer. This offers superior, long-lasting corrosion and abrasion protection compared to the thin layer of standard zinc plating. HDG provides both a barrier and cathodic (sacrificial) protection for the steel underneath.

What happens if I don’t use a torque wrench?

Failing to use a torque wrench creates significant safety risks. It can lead to under-tightening, causing connections to loosen from vibration. Over-tightening can strip threads or damage components, leading to catastrophic failure in critical assemblies. Proper torque ensures reliability and safety.

How do I identify a bolt’s grade?

You can identify a bolt’s grade by the markings on its head.

  • SAE J429: Grade 5 bolts have 3 radial lines; Grade 8 bolts have 6.
  • ISO 898-1: Metric bolts have numerical property classes like 8.8 or 10.9 stamped on the head.
